欢迎学习《基于Karate框架API测试自动化核心技能训练视频教程》课程,这是一门易于遵循的Karate框架教程,即使没有经验也可以构建 API 测试自动化技能。
发表于 2022 年 11 月
MP4 | 视频:h264、1280×720 | 音频:AAC,44.1 KHz,2 Ch
类型:eLearning | 语言:英语 | 时长:17 节课(4 小时 11 分钟)| 大小:2.2 GB
你会学到什么
- 了解Karate测试自动化框架的优势
- 使用Karate测试框架自动化 API 测试
- 使用Karate测试框架来自动化自定义测试,例如验证数据库中的记录、消息代理中的事件等
- 使用Karate通过标签控制测试执行
要求
对 API 的基本了解和测试自动化的重要性。Java 的背景知识很有帮助,但不是强制性的。
描述
测试自动化是一项不断需要的技能,拥有适当技能的个人受到高度追捧。如今几乎所有的 Web 应用程序和服务都通过 API 进行通信,API 测试自动化作为一项技能变得更加重要。
了解如何使用空手道测试框架自动化 API 测试,该框架已成为世界上使用最广泛的测试自动化框架之一。参加本课程不需要 API 测试自动化方面的经验或任何编程专业知识。但是,需要具备 API 的基本知识和对自动化重要性的一般理解。
这是一门实践课程,将涵盖以下主题:-
框架安装和设置
了解标准Karate项目结构
验证 REST GET、PUT、DELETE、POST API
使用请求响应标头、查询参数、cookies
使用模糊匹配处理复杂响应
验证公共以及受限/经过身份验证的 API
使用标签控制测试执行
数据驱动测试
与 Java 和 Javascript 代码互操作
使用 Java 互操作的自定义测试验证
编写模块化测试
环境切换
介绍 retry-until、before-after 钩子等功能
并行化测试执行
在课程结束时,您将拥有足够的知识来自己开始 API 测试自动化,并自信地将技能组合添加到您的简历中。
本课程适用于谁
想要学习 API 测试自动化的初学者软件工程师